Try and monitor your blood pressure for a few days may be 7-10 days regularly. Monitor your b.p twice in a day, morning and evening. If your b.p is always above that 140 mark then your dosage might be changed.
Otherwise b.p around 140 mark is considered good at that age ,other risk factors need to be assessed like your diabetic status and obesity but first of all you monitor your b.p for a few days regularly with your normal diet pattern (which should be low salt and oil intake)

Yes, I suggest that a workup done to investigate why you still have bleeding, if this is still menstrual period or post-menopausal bleeding. Please have a transvaginal ultrasound done. If endometrial stripe is thick, you may discuss with your gynecologist if endometrial biopsy is warranted. ...
